Pediatric Sports Medicine at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children
Each year, more than 3.5 million children in the U.S. are treated for sports injuries. To address the
growing need for children’s sports medicine in Central Florida,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children provides
comprehensive services through its Pediatric Sports Medicine Faculty Practice. The practice uses a multidisciplinary
approach to treatment, rehabilitation, education and prevention with the goal of providing care for and prevention
of athletic injuries in children, without concern for ability to pay.

Common Injuries
Because their bodies are growing, children require different coaching, conditioning and medical care than more mature athletes.
Uneven growth areas in children leave young athletes more susceptible to injury. And when children focus on just one sport,
they often incur injuries caused by excessive, repetitive stress.

Diagnosis and Rehabilitation
Our Pediatric Sports Medicine Faculty Practice features onsite access to a leading edge MRI and 64-slice CT scanner,
providing immediate diagnosis for patients. After diagnosis and treatment, our specialists are able to monitor and
guide young athletes to rehabilitation through in-house physical therapy.
Prevention and Education
Prevention of injuries, through the most scientific, cutting edge training techniques, is the main focus
of our sports medicine staff. With specialized knowledge and understanding of the unique nature of a growing
child, we promote and teach the best ‘Safe Play’ habits to young athletes, which are designed to prevent
sports injuries in children and teens.
The Pediatric Sports Medicine Center is under the direction of Jay Albright, MD, who is one of
10 physicians in the country with full fellowships in both pediatric orthopedic surgery and
orthopedic sports medicine.
